import type { Component, Snippet } from "svelte"; interface SettingsItem { key: string; path: string; icon: Component; label: string; } interface SettingsSection { group: string; items: SettingsItem[]; } interface Props { customSections?: SettingsSection[]; profile?: Snippet; appearance?: Snippet; roles?: Snippet; security?: Snippet; integrations?: Snippet; notifications?: Snippet; api?: Snippet; audit?: Snippet; about?: Snippet; content?: Snippet<[string]>; } declare const SettingsPage: Component; type SettingsPage = ReturnType; export default SettingsPage;